A Relaxing Day in Kashmir

8:00 AM: Arrive in Srinagar

Welcome to the beautiful city of Srinagar, the summer capital of Jammu and Kashmir. After arriving at the airport, take a taxi to your hotel and check-in. Take some time to relax and freshen up before starting your day of relaxation in Kashmir.

10:00 AM: Shikara Ride on Dal Lake

Start your day with a peaceful Shikara ride on Dal Lake. Glide along the tranquil waters surrounded by snow-capped mountains and lush gardens. Admire the floating gardens, known as "Rakhs," and enjoy the serenity of the surrounding nature. The ride will cost approximately INR 500 per hour.

12:00 PM: Visit Mughal Gardens

Head to the renowned Mughal Gardens, specifically Nishat Bagh and Shalimar Bagh. These stunning gardens were built during the Mughal era and offer a breathtaking view of the Dal Lake. Take a leisurely stroll through the manicured lawns, vibrant flowerbeds, and cascading fountains. Entrance fees are around INR 20 per person.

2:00 PM: Lunch at a Houseboat

Indulge in a traditional Kashmiri lunch served on a houseboat. These floating accommodations offer a unique dining experience with panoramic views of the lake. Taste the local cuisine, including Rogan Josh, Yakhni, and Kashmiri Pulao, while enjoying the peaceful ambiance. Prices for a lunch experience on a houseboat range from INR 800 to INR 1500 per person.

4:00 PM: Shopping at Lal Chowk

Visit Lal Chowk, the main marketplace of Srinagar. Explore a variety of shops, selling traditional Kashmiri handicrafts, pashminas, spices, and souvenirs. Bargain with the shopkeepers to get the best deals and immerse yourself in the vibrant local culture. Allocate around two hours for shopping and keep a budget of INR 2000 to INR 5000.

6:00 PM: Sunset at Shankaracharya Temple

End your day with a visit to Shankaracharya Temple, situated atop the Shankaracharya Hill. Enjoy the panoramic views of Srinagar and the surrounding mountains as the sun sets. Experience a sense of tranquility and spiritual connection in this serene spot. The entrance to the temple is free, and it takes about 30 minutes to reach the top of the hill.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For those seeking a more off the beaten path experience, consider visiting the Nigeen Lake, a quieter and less crowded alternative to Dal Lake. You can also explore the old city area of Srinagar, known as "Downtown," to experience the local way of life and indulge in traditional Kashmiri street food like Kebabs and Seekh Tujj. Additionally, a visit to Dachigam National Park, located just outside the city, offers a chance to immerse yourself in Kashmir's natural beauty and spot wildlife such as endangered Hangul deer.
